GTA 6 Price Could Change the Gaming World Forever

Developer Michael Douse has stated that the upcoming GTA 6 could shake up the gaming industry with its price tag and completely change the game pricing trend. Game pricing has been a big topic of discussion in recent years, especially with next-gen games starting to be priced around $70. Looking back to the late 90s, game prices hovered between 50-60 dollars on Xbox, N64 and PlayStation platforms, and despite the exponential increase in production costs, these prices did not show a big increase for a long time.

GTA 6 Price and the Future of the Game Industry

But that could change with the release of GTA VI. Douse, the editorial director of Baldur’s Gate 3, suggests that Rockstar Games could charge much more than $70, and that this price could set a new standard for how games are priced in the future. “Almost all games should be more expensive at a base level because the cost of producing them (e.g. inflation) outpaces price trends,” he said on Twitter.

This statement coincides with criticism that many games are released in “top-tier editions” with unfinished content, and that high prices are charged for these editions. “I think a game should be priced according to its quality, breadth and depth,” Douse said.

As for GTA VI, rumor has it that this new Grand Theft Auto game cost around 1 billion dollars to make. Given such a high budget, even a $70 price tag could easily cover this cost. However, Rockstar Games and Take-Two may want to consider a higher price tag to do justice to the investment and the talent of the team.

Finally, Douse said, “All games should be more expensive on a fundamental level,” before adding, “I don’t think we’ll get there with promises of DLC, more with quality and communication. Everyone is just waiting for GTA VI to do that lol”, he concluded. And if any game is going to be released with a higher price and be accepted by gamers, it will definitely be GTA VI.
